The Anti-Narcotics Force (ANF) has announced that it assisted in the busting of a transnational drug trafficking network, resulting in the seizure of 671 kilograms of methamphetamine (ICE).

According to ANF, the operation involved intelligence sharing with US and Sri Lankan authorities, leading to the recovery of 200 kilograms of methamphetamine from a container at Karachi Port.

The ANF identified the mastermind of the network as Ehsanullah, an Afghan, and mentioned that local handlers were also arrested.

Further investigations led to the recovery of 471 kilograms of methamphetamine at Colombo Port, concealed in towels, through a joint operation coordinated by the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) and Sri Lankan authorities.

The ANF stated that the network was attempting to use Pakistani territory as a transit route for transporting narcotics to international destinations.

Pakistan remains both a transit and victim state for Afghan-origin drugs, according to ANF, which utilised advanced intelligence-based strategies to identify the network.

The successful operation reflects ANF’s professional capabilities, commitment to combating narcotics trafficking, and its effective cooperation with international law enforcement agencies.

ANF’s efforts in dismantling international drug trafficking organisations and apprehending Afghan drug traffickers and their local facilitators have been formally acknowledged by Sri Lankan authorities and the US DEA, underscoring ANF’s effective role in international counter-narcotics cooperation.
